Why Not Barter?
We live in a society now where money is everything.
Heck, I think we all would agree that having a large money growing tree in the backyard would be quite ideal.
Hey, I bet people would be more amped on planting trees!I hate to do it, but let s be realistic.
Money does not grow on trees, at least not for me.
So what are some different ways that we get money? We work, we sell things, we invest, and so on.
That all sounds great, but there may come a time in one s life where money is scarce.
You may be unemployed, not have any assets to sell, or have your money invested in anything.
So what does one do?Consider this.
Why don t we get rid of all currency and barter for things? Just think of all the different types of services that people could offer.
I feel as though people in our society would have closer relationships with one another.
It would force us to communicate on more of a personal level.
It would also allow us to put ourselves out there and really figure out our self-worth.
You would really discover what you are good at and stick with it.
Creativity juices would be flowing as people would be coming up with different ways to offer their services in exchange for someone else s.
I feel it would also give more value to the things we both want and need.
I bet our “want” list would get cut down pretty quickly if we knew how much labor and resources it would require to get.Maybe then you wouldn t hear about how all these huge companies have to file for debt settlement and bankruptcy because they are so far in the hole that they can t dig themselves out.
We wouldn t have to trust other people with our money, therefore the only person we could blame for not having certain things is ourselves.
It won t be, “the bank lost my money, my account was hacked into”, and so on.Really, just imagine the possibilities with this.
I bet the homeless rate and the poverty rate would decrease as well.
Hey, at this point, it s worth giving it a shot, right?
